The agency is demanding that I pay a fine of 1600B when I check into the apartment for not registering at the hotel where I stayed for 2 weeks before I checked in. Has anyone experienced this? Am I the one who has to pay this fine? Pattaya.

It's not their responsibility. If they are that principled, offer to have them do the registration for you and pay the fine on the check from immigration, if there is one.

Upon arrival, it is necessary to register within 3 days if a fine of 1600 is overdue. If you go directly to the hotel, the hotel registers.
